🔥 云服务器软件下载终极指南:一键部署,效率飙升!

云服务器软件下载:从基础概念到高效实践指南

在当今数字化时代,云服务器已成为企业和个人部署应用、存储数据及运行服务的核心基础设施。然而,仅仅租用一台云服务器实例只是第一步,如何为其下载并配置合适的软件,才是释放其全部潜力的关键。本文将深入探讨云服务器软件下载的各个环节,为您提供一份清晰的实践指南。

首先,理解云服务器的环境是软件下载的前提。与个人电脑不同,云服务器通常运行着无图形界面的操作系统,如Linux的各种发行版(Ubuntu, CentOS等)或Windows Server。这意味着,绝大多数软件下载和安装需要通过命令行终端来完成。因此,掌握基本的命令行操作,是高效管理云服务器的基石。

软件下载的核心途径是依赖系统的包管理器。对于Linux系统,这通常是高效且安全的首选方法。例如,在Ubuntu或Debian系统中,使用apt-get update && apt-get install [软件包名]命令;在CentOS或RHEL中,则使用yum install [软件包名]。这些命令会从官方维护的软件仓库中自动下载、验证并安装软件及其所有依赖项,极大地简化了流程并保证了系统的稳定性与安全性。

当所需软件不在官方仓库中,或您需要特定版本时,直接从开发者官网下载成为另一常见选择。通常,您可以使用wgetcurl这类命令行工具,直接获取软件的压缩包(如.tar.gz或.zip文件)。例如:wget https://example.com/software.tar.gz。下载完成后,再通过解压、编译(对于源码)或移动到特定目录来完成安装。这种方式灵活性高,但需要用户自行处理依赖关系和更新维护。

此外,现代软件部署中,容器技术正变得越来越重要。通过Docker,您可以直接从Docker Hub等镜像仓库“下载”(拉取)包含完整运行环境的软件镜像,命令如docker pull [镜像名]。这种方式将软件与其环境彻底打包,确保了跨云服务器环境的一致性,是微服务架构和持续集成的理想选择。

在下载和安装软件的过程中,安全性与合规性不容忽视。务必仅从官方或可信的来源获取软件,并验证文件的完整性(如通过SHA256校验和)。同时,定期使用包管理器更新系统补丁和软件版本,以修复已知漏洞。对于生产环境的云服务器,建议先在测试环境中进行部署验证。

总而言之,云服务器软件下载并非简单的点击安装,而是一个涉及系统知识、工具选择和安全考量的综合过程。无论是使用包管理器追求效率与稳定,还是直接下载以获得灵活性,或是采用容器技术拥抱现代化部署,理解其背后的原理并遵循最佳实践,都将帮助您更自信、更高效地驾驭云端资源,为您的项目构建坚实可靠的技术栈。

文章插图
文章插图
文章插图

评论(3)

发表评论

环保爱好者 2023-06-15 14:30
这是一个非常重要的协议!希望各国能够真正落实承诺,为我们的子孙后代留下一个更美好的地球。
回复 点赞(15)
气候变化研究者 2023-06-15 12:15
协议内容令人鼓舞,但关键还在于执行。我们需要建立有效的监督机制,确保各国履行承诺。同时,技术创新也是实现减排目标的关键。
回复 点赞(8)
普通市民 2023-06-15 10:45
作为普通人,我们也能为气候变化做出贡献。比如减少使用一次性塑料制品,选择公共交通等。希望更多人加入到环保行动中来。
回复 点赞(22)